C&O/B&O In Color See the B&MBob Withers As the merger scene in the eastern United States heated up in the early 1960s with Erie Lackawanna, N&W NKP Wabash, and talk of Penn Central, a union of a different type occurred between the Chesapeake& Ohio and the Baltimore & Ohio.
